Key Challenges We Overcame
- Zero Organic Visibility at Start
The website had no ranking keywords nor any organic traffic, making it invisible in search results and completely reliant on paid or referral channels. - Content Gaps Across All Pages
There was a lack of search-optimized content and no keyword-targeted pages to attract or engage users based on their intent. - Technical SEO Limitations
Site health started at 91%, with issues related to indexing, metadata, broken links, and mobile responsiveness; all affecting crawlability and performance. - No Prior SEO Infrastructure or History
There were no historical benchmarks, no tracking systems in place, and no data to build upon — requiring a full SEO build from the ground up. - Minimal Brand Authority in Search
The domain had low authority, with no backlinks or referring domains, limiting its ability to compete moderately in the competitive keyword spaces. - Slow Initial Growth Curve
Early quarters (Q1 & Q2) showed gradual traffic movement (e.g., 76 → 320 visits), requiring patience, data discipline, and continuous optimization to gain traction.

The Winning Outcomes
In just one year, client VL transformed from having no search presence to achieving meaningful, measurable SEO performance. With strategic consistency and precision, the brand gained visibility, traffic, and authority — starting from zero.
- Organic Traffic Growth
Beginning with zero monthly traffic in January, the site recorded continuous quarter-over-quarter growth, reaching 451 monthly visits by Q4. While the numbers may seem modest, this traffic would have cost approximately $133/month if acquired via Google Ads — validating the long-term value of organic acquisition. - Keyword Rankings
From zero keyword rankings at the start, we reached 15 first-page keywords by December. This represented a major visibility milestone for a brand building authority from scratch. - Site Health Optimization
Site health significantly improved, rising from 91% in February to 99% by December, ensuring strong technical performance and an SEO-ready structure. - Year-over-Year Impact: November 2023 vs. November 2024
- Clicks increased by 2700%
- Impressions jumped by 18,750%
- While the average position dropped, this reflected an expansion in the number of organic keywords ranked — showing wider reach and improved keyword diversity.
